Master's
For my master's, I worked on a project that aimed to speed up the design of FPGAs. My work involved automatically designing an FPGA. Previously developed tools were used to automate the circuit generation and layout and using these tools along with some new features, we were able to make a complete FPGA. We really made it and taped it out. See the papers and thesis below for more details.

PhD
I'm working on the automated electrical design of FPGAs. This automation is used to explore the different trade-offs that are possible in the design of FPGAs.
